Long before the invention of high-speed cameras, Edgar Degas used his keen observational skills to study the mechanical nuances of a horse’s gait. This edgar degas horse art print captures that fascination, presenting five riders in a sprawling green meadow. The composition is famously unconventional, cropping some figures while focusing on the subtle tension in the animals’ muscles and the colorful silks of the jockeys. A soft, hazy palette of sage greens, sky blues, and warm chestnut browns creates a breathable, atmospheric scene that is hallmark Impressionism.
The artwork evokes the quiet anticipation found at the start of a race, far from the chaotic roar of the crowd. It reflects an era when the racetrack was as much a place for social observation as it was for sport. By focusing on the horses in repose or slow movement, the piece conveys a sense of disciplined energy and pastoral calm, inviting the viewer to slow down and appreciate the interplay of light and form.
